🔰 Daily The Hindu Vocabulary | 13.11.2022 ✅
1. TRANSITIONAL (ADJECTIVE): (माध्यमिक): Intermediate
Synonyms: Middle, Midway
Antonyms: Initial
Example Sentence:
A transitional government had been appointed.
2. EXPATRIATE (ADJECTIVE): (प्रवासी): Emigrant
Synonyms: Non-native, Displaced
Antonyms: Native
Example Sentence:
Expatriate workers were returning to their cities.
3. DIRECTIVE (NOUN): (निदेशात्मक): Instruction
Synonyms: Direction, Command
Antonyms: Lawlessness
Example Sentence
A new EC directive has been forwarded for approval.
4. OUTLAW (VERB): (गैरकानूनी घोषित करना): Ban
Synonyms: Bar prohibit
Antonyms: Permit
Example Sentence:
Secondary picketing has finally been outlawed.
5. DISASTROUS (ADJECTIVE): (उत्पातक): Catastrophic
Synonyms: Calamitous, Cataclysmic
Antonyms: Fortunate
Example Sentence:
A disastrous fire swept through the museum.
6. ISOLATION (NOUN): (एकांत): Separation
Synonyms: Segregation, Quarantine
Antonyms: Contact
Example Sentence:
Isolation from family and friends may also contribute to anxiety.
7. RIGOROUS (ADJECTIVE): (सख्त): Strict
Synonyms: Severe, Stern
Antonyms: Lax
Example Sentence:
Rigorous controls on mergers are needed.
8. SPARK (VERB): (बढ़ावा देना): Give rise to
Synonyms: Cause, Set in motion
Antonyms: Bring to an end
Example Sentence:
The trial sparked a furious row.
9. MANDATORY (ADJECTIVE): (अनिवार्य): Obligatory
Synonyms: Compulsory, Binding
Antonyms: Optional
Example Sentence:
Wearing helmets was made mandatory for pedal cyclists.
10. STEEP (ADJECTIVE): (बहुत ढालवाँ): Precipitous
Synonyms: Sheer, Abrupt
Antonyms: Gentle
Example Sentence:
She pushed the bike up the steep hill.

🔰 Daily The Hindu Vocabulary | 14.11.2022 ✅
1. ATTEST (VERB): (संपुष्टि करना): Certify
Synonyms: Corroborate, Confirm
Antonyms: Disprove
Example Sentence:
The witnesses must attest and sign the will in the testator's presence.
2. VOLATILE (ADJECTIVE): (परिवर्तनशील): Tense
Synonyms: Strained, Fraught
Antonyms: Stable
Example Sentence:
The political situation was becoming more volatile.
3. DEMARCATION (NOUN): (सीमांकन): Separation
Synonyms: Distinction, Differentiation
Antonyms: Indefiniteness
Example Sentence:
The demarcation of the maritime border was essential.
4. EXPEDITE (VERB): (शीघ्रता करना): Speed up
Synonyms: Accelerate, Hurry
Antonyms: Delay
Example Sentence:
He promised to expedite economic reforms.
5. DEMOLITION (NOUN): (विध्वंस): Destruction
Synonyms: Knocking down, Flattening
Antonyms: Construction
Example Sentence:
The monument was saved from demolition.
6. FATALITY (NOUN): (मृत्यु): Death
Synonyms: Casualty, Mortality
Antonyms: Birth
Example Sentence:
Pedestrian fatalities seldom occur in built-up areas.
7. ADAPTATION (NOUN): (अनुकूलन): Converting
Synonyms: Conversion, Alteration
Antonyms: Incongruity
Example Sentence:
The adaptation of a teaching strategy is needed.
8. HAZARDOUS (ADJECTIVE): (खतरनाक): Dangerous
Synonyms: Risky, Unsafe
Antonyms: Safe
Example Sentence:
We have to work in hazarus conditions.
9. PROLONG (VERB): (बढ़ाना): Lengthen
Synonyms: Extend, Draw out
Antonyms: Shorten
Example Sentence:
I don’t want to prolong the discussion.
10. RETAIN (NOUN): (रखे रहना): Keep
Synonyms: Hold on to, Hold fast to
Antonyms: Give up
Example Sentence:
Labour retained the seat.
